The simple REPL provides a limited Python experience in the browser.
<a href="https://github.com/python/cpython/blob/main/Tools/wasm/README.md">
Tools/wasm/README.md</a> contains a list of known limitations and
issues. Networking, subprocesses, and threading are not available.
